Lemon Mustard Chicken

Lemon Mustard Chicken: A Zesty Delight for HCG Diet

Looking for a zesty twist to your chicken dinner? This Lemon Mustard Chicken is not just bursting with flavour but is also suitable for those on Phase 2 and Phase 3 of the HCG diet. Let’s dive into how to make this simple yet delicious dish.

Ingredients

For this tangy chicken dish, you’ll need:

  • 140g Boneless Skinless Chicken Breast – The lean protein star.
  • 1/2 Lemon, Juiced – For that citrus kick.
  • 1 Teaspoon Lemon Zest – Adds extra lemony zing.
  • 1 Tablespoon Dijon Mustard – For a sharp, tangy flavour.
  • 1/2 Tablespoon Dried Chives – Brings a mild onion-like taste.
  • 1/4 Teaspoon Salt + Extra for Spinach – To season.
  • 1/4 Teaspoon Pepper – Just enough to spice things up.
  • Roughly Chopped Spinach – Your green, nutrient-packed veggie.
  • 1/8 Teaspoon Garlic Powder – For a hint of garlic.

Method: How to Whip It Up

Marinate & Grill the Chicken

  1. Mix Marinade: In a bowl, whisk lemon juice, zest, Dijon mustard, chives, salt, and pepper together.
  2. Marinate: Place chicken in a plastic bag or shallow dish and pour the marinade over it. Let it sit in the fridge for 1-2 hours.
  3. Grill Chicken: Heat your grill and cook the chicken for 5-7 minutes on each side until perfectly done.

Prepare the Spinach

  1. Sauté Spinach: In a pan over medium-high heat, sauté the spinach for 2-3 minutes until it softens.
  2. Season: Sprinkle with a bit more salt and the garlic powder.

Serve Hot

Plate the grilled chicken with a side of seasoned spinach and enjoy your lemony, mustardy creation!

FAQs

Can I use fresh chives instead of dried ones?

Absolutely! Fresh chives will give the dish a more vibrant flavor. Use about 1 tablespoon since fresh herbs are typically stronger than dried.

What can I serve with lemon mustard chicken in HCG Phase 2?

Stick to HCG diet-approved vegetables like spinach or other greens in this recipe to keep your meal compliant.

How long can I keep the leftovers?

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at gently to avoid drying out the chicken.
